CBS PARTNERS WITH YOGURTLAND ON A SWEET FALL PROMOTION FOR THE NETWORK'S EIGHT COMEDY SERIES

Here's the scoop... CBS is teaming up with Yogurtland on a sweet three-tier fall promotion for the Network's eight comedy series that will kick off this Friday:

· From Friday, Sept. 13 through Monday, Sept. 30, select Yogurtland locations in several major cities will offer CBS comedy series-inspired frozen yogurt flavors and store-wide branding, marking Yogurtland's first in-store takeover by a television network.

· On Premiere Monday (Sept. 23) the same participating Yogurtland shops will provide free frozen yogurt from Noon to 6:00 PM.

· All Yogurtland shops throughout the country will accept CBS comedy-branded coupons for a free first five ounces of frozen yogurt on Monday, Sept. 23. (Coupons can be accessed/printed via CBS's comedy series' Facebook pages and Yogurtland's official Facebook page.)

This fall will be more appetizing than ever for CBS comedy fans. With CBS's largest number of comedies since its 1997-1998 schedule, it's Comedy's Best Season. The returning hits THE BIG BANG THEORY, HOW I MET YOUR MOTHER, 2 BROKE GIRLS and TWO AND A HALF MEN will be joined by the highly anticipated new comedies THE CRAZY ONES, THE MILLERS, MOM and WE ARE MEN.

Among the numerous flavors inspired by these series or their characters are:

· WE ARE MEN - "We Are Man-go" (Mango)

· THE MILLERS - "Chocolate Miller Shake" (Chocolate Milk Shake)

· MOM - "Mom's Hot Cocoa Meltdown" (Peppermint Hot Cocoa)

· THE CRAZY ONES - "Cookies & Crazy Ones" (Cookies and Cream)

· THE BIG BANG THEORY - "Penny's Cheesecake" (NY Cheesecake), "Howard's Strawberry Space Adventure" (Fresh Strawberry) and "Sheldon's Bazinga Blueberry" (Blueberry Tart)

· HOW I MET YOUR MOTHER - "Plain with Robin Sparkles" (Plain Tart), "How I Met Your Mocha" (Almond Midnight Mocha) and "Barney's Legend-Berry Tart" (Maqui Berry Tart)

· TWO AND A HALF MEN - "Two and a Half Pistachios" (Pistachio)

· 2 BROKE GIRLS - "2 Broke Graham Crackers" (Cinnamon Graham Cracker) and "Max and Caroline's Cupcake Batter" (Red Velvet Cupcake Batter)

Information about CBS's new comedy series:

WE ARE MEN, premiering Monday, Sept. 30 (8:30-9:00 PM, ET/PT), is about four single guys living in a short-term apartment complex who unexpectedly find camaraderie over their many missteps in love. Carter (Chris Smith), the youngest and most recent addition to the group, moved in after being ditched at the altar mid-ceremony, and is now eager to re-enter the dating scene and get on with his life with some guidance from his "band of brothers:" Frank Russo, a middle-aged clothing manufacturer and four-time divorc�e who still fancies himself a ladies man (Golden Globe and multiple Emmy Award winner Tony Shalhoub); Gil Bartis, a small business owner who was caught having the world's worst affair (Kal Penn); and Stuart Weber, a speedo-wearing OB/GYN who's hiding his assets until his second divorce is settled (Jerry O'Connell). Rebecca Breeds also stars.

MOM, premiering Monday, Sept. 23 (9:30-10:00 PM, ET/PT), stars Anna Faris as Christy, a newly sober single mom and waitress raising two children in a world full of temptations and pitfalls, and multiple Emmy Award winner Allison Janney stars as Bonnie, Christy's critical, estranged mother. Christy's sobriety is tested when her recovering alcoholic mom Bonnie reappears, chock-full of passive-aggressive insights into Christy's many mistakes. Nate Corddry, Matt Jones, Sadie Calvano, Blake Garrett Rosenthal, Spencer Daniels and French Stewart also star.

THE CRAZY ONES premieres Thursday, Sept. 26 (9:00-9:30 PM, ET/PT) and stars Academy Award winner Robin Williams, who returns to series television as larger-than-life advertising genius Simon Roberts, whose unorthodox methods and unpredictable behavior would get him fired... if he weren't the boss. Sarah Michelle Gellar, James Wolk, Hamish Linklater and Amanda Setton also star.

THE MILLERS, premiering Thursday, Oct. 3 (8:30-9:00 PM, ET/PT), stars Will Arnett as Nathan Miller, a recently divorced local roving news reporter looking forward to living the singles' life until the unexpected marital troubles of his parents (Emmy Award winner Margo Martindale and Emmy Award winner Beau Bridges) suddenly derail his plans. Jayma Mays, JB Smoove, Nelson Franklin and Eve Moon also star.

Returning dates for CBS's returning comedy series:

HOW I MET YOUR MOTHER returns for its ninth and final season with a special one-hour episode on Monday, Sept. 23 (8:00-9:00 PM, ET/PT). Josh Radnor, Jason Segel, Cobie Smulders, Neil Patrick Harris, Alyson Hannigan and Cristin Milioti star.

The third season premiere of 2 BROKE GIRLS is Monday, Sept. 23 (9:00-9:30 PM, ET/PT). The series stars Kat Dennings, Beth Behrs, Matthew Moy, Jonathan Kite, Garrett Morris and Jennifer Coolidge.

THE BIG BANG THEORY returns for its seventh season with a special one-hour episode, Thursday, Sept. 26 (8:00-9:00 PM, ET/PT). Johnny Galecki, Jim Parsons, Kaley Cuoco, Simon Helberg, Kunal Nayyar, Mayim Bialik and Melissa Rauch star.

The 11th season premiere of TWO AND A HALF MEN is Thursday, Sept. 26 (9:30-10:00 PM, ET/PT). The series stars Ashton Kutcher, Jon Cryer and Conchata Ferrell.
